Experience:
Dan Chappuis began his career in education as a teacher in Nevada in 1996, where he taught physical education/health, biology, and physical science until 2007. He and his family relocated to Valdosta, Georgia, where he taught biology for four years before becoming an assistant principal, serving in that role for ten years. He came to Colquitt County High School as principal in 2021. Chappuis began his tenure as Colquitt County School District Superintendent in May of 2024.
Education:
- B.S. Degree in Education (Major: Physical Education/Health, Minor: Biology) - University of Montana-Western
- M.A. Degree in Education Administration – Grand Canyon University
- Ed.S. Degree in Educational Leadership – Valdosta State University

Colquitt County School District Annual Budget Calendar
- August – December: Discussions with Superintendent, District Administrators, School Administrators regarding current & future budget items
- January – February: District level Administrators hold meetings to discuss system & building level needs, including staffing projections
- March – April: Finance department compiles first draft of General Fund budget
- May: Board meets in a retreat setting to review tentative budget
- June: Proposed Budget-Public meetings (2); Final Budget and annual millage rate resolution are Board approved
